These five papers, plus an introduction, are taken from a workshop held in Athens in 1996, focusing on the `Acquisition and distribution of raw materials and finished products' in pre-Iron Age Greece. Contents: Decoding inferences in models of obsidian exchange: Contexts of value transformation in the Neolithic Aegean (Lia Karimali) ; Craft production at Knossos - the Linear B evidence (Hedvig Landenius Enegren) ; Acquisition and distribution: ta-ra-si-ja in the Mycenaean textile industry (Marie-Louise Bech Nosch) ; Metals to metalworkers:A view to the east (Iphiyenia Tournavitou & Michael Sugerman) ; Mycenaean age lead: A fresh look at an old material
